* [PATCH v4] jfs: UBSAN: shift-out-of-bounds in dbFindBits
2024-10-25 6:49 syzbot
@ 2024-11-01 9:59 Matt Jan
2024-11-01 10:20 ` [syzbot] [jfs?] UBSAN: shift-out-of-bounds in dbFindBits (2) syzbot
-1 siblings, 1 reply; 6+ messages in thread
From: Matt Jan @ 2024-11-01 9:59 UTC (permalink / raw)
To: Dave Kleikamp, jfs-discussion, linux-kernel, Shuan Khan
Cc: Matt Jan, syzbot+9e90a1c5eedb9dc4c6cc
Ensure l2nb is less than BUDMIN by performing a sanity check in the caller.
Return -EIO if the check fails.
#syz test
Reported-by: syzbot+9e90a1c5eedb9dc4c6cc@syzkaller.appspotmail.com
Signed-off-by: Matt Jan <zoo868e@gmail.com>
---
Changes in v4: Thanks to Shaggy for the review. We now perform a sanity check instead of continuing as if nothing is wrong.
Changes in v3: Return the result earlier instead of assert it
Changes in v2: Test if the patch resolve the issue through syzbot and reference the reporter
fs/jfs/jfs_dmap.c | 4 ++--
1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)
diff --git a/fs/jfs/jfs_dmap.c b/fs/jfs/jfs_dmap.c
index 974ecf5e0d95..89c22a18314f 100644
--- a/fs/jfs/jfs_dmap.c
+++ b/fs/jfs/jfs_dmap.c
@@ -1217,7 +1217,7 @@ dbAllocNear(struct bmap * bmp,
int word, lword, rc;
s8 *leaf;
- if (dp->tree.leafidx != cpu_to_le32(LEAFIND)) {
+ if (dp->tree.leafidx != cpu_to_le32(LEAFIND) || l2nb >= L2DBWORD) {
jfs_error(bmp->db_ipbmap->i_sb, "Corrupt dmap page\n");
return -EIO;
}
@@ -1969,7 +1969,7 @@ dbAllocDmapLev(struct bmap * bmp,
if (dbFindLeaf((dmtree_t *) &dp->tree, l2nb, &leafidx, false))
return -ENOSPC;
- if (leafidx < 0)
+ if (leafidx < 0 || l2nb >= L2DBWORD)
return -EIO;
/* determine the block number within the file system corresponding
--
2.25.1
^ permalink raw reply related [flat|nested] 6+ messages in thread* [PATCH v3] jfs: UBSAN: shift-out-of-bounds in dbFindBits
2024-10-25 6:49 syzbot
@ 2024-10-25 17:00 Matt Jan
2024-10-25 17:20 ` [syzbot] [jfs?] UBSAN: shift-out-of-bounds in dbFindBits (2) syzbot
-1 siblings, 1 reply; 6+ messages in thread
From: Matt Jan @ 2024-10-25 17:00 UTC (permalink / raw)
To: Dave Kleikamp, jfs-discussion, linux-kernel, Shuah Khan
Cc: Matt Jan, syzbot+9e90a1c5eedb9dc4c6cc
Return immediately if the needed free bits span a full word to avoid
out-of-bounds shifting.
#syz test
Reported-by: syzbot+9e90a1c5eedb9dc4c6cc@syzkaller.appspotmail.com
Signed-off-by: Matt Jan <zoo868e@gmail.com>
---
Changes in v3: Return the result earlier instead of assert it
Changes in v2: Test if the patch resolve the issue through syzbot and
reference the reporter.
fs/jfs/jfs_dmap.c | 5 +++++
1 file changed, 5 insertions(+)
diff --git a/fs/jfs/jfs_dmap.c b/fs/jfs/jfs_dmap.c
index 974ecf5e0d95..45b7a393b769 100644
--- a/fs/jfs/jfs_dmap.c
+++ b/fs/jfs/jfs_dmap.c
@@ -3012,6 +3012,11 @@ static int dbFindBits(u32 word, int l2nb)
int bitno, nb;
u32 mask;
+ /* return immediately if the number of free bits is a word
+ */
+ if (l2nb == BUDMIN)
+ return (!!word) << BUDMIN;
+
/* get the number of bits.
*/
nb = 1 << l2nb;
--
2.25.1
